!wTV .. .....1/ ........................ <br />ORDINANCE NO. 150 <br />AN ORDINANCE AMENDING SECTION 5 OF CHAPTER <br />2 OF GENERAL ORDINANCE NO. 3709, WHICH IS <br />SECTION 3 OF ORDINANCE NO. 3645 ADOPTED ON <br />THE 8th DAY OF JUNE, 1948. <br />BE IT ORDAINED by the Common Council of the City of South Bend, Indiana: <br />SECTION I. That Section 5 of Chapter 2 of General Ordinance No. 3709, <br />which is Section 3 of Ordinance No. 3645 adopted on the 8th day of June, <br />1948, be and the same is hereby amended to read as follows: <br />All officers and employees of the City, and each department, shall <br />be entitled to fifteen (15) days annual vacation, except that members <br />of the Fire Department and the Police Department shall be entitled <br />to twenty -one (21) days annual vacation from the 11th year to the <br />20th year of their service, inclusive, and further the members of <br />the Fire Department shall be entitled to twenty -three (23) days <br />annual vacation from and including their 21st year of service. <br />SECTION II.
